Every personal injury case is different. There is no one-size-fits-all solution to accident claims. The length of the claims process will depend on the severity of your injuries, the willingness of the other party to settle, the court’s caseload, and more.

In general, personal injury cases can take anywhere from several months to a few years. It’s important to contact an attorney as soon as possible to get your case started. Each state has a statute of limitations for personal injury cases, after which you will lose your right of action.

When you hire The Advocates, we will begin investigating your accident immediately while you finish medical treatment. Once all evidence and medical records have been compiled, your attorney will send a demand letter to the other party’s insurance company. At this point, negotiations will begin.

In many cases, a settlement can be reached during negotiations. If the other party refuses to make a fair offer, you may choose to file a suit. In the litigation phase, your attorney will represent you in court in front of a judge, jury, and/or arbitrator.

California Pedestrian Accident Statistics


Man in black outfit walks across crosswalk while car makes a right turn. Motion blur

California pedestrian accident statistics

  • California’s pedestrian fatality rate is nearly 25% higher than the national average.
  • Nearly 150 pedestrians were killed in Los Angeles alone in 2021.
  • In 2021, pedestrians made up more than 25% of all traffic fatalities in California.
  • Most pedestrian accidents happen when it is dark outside.
  • Nationwide, a pedestrian is killed in an accident about every 71 minutes, according to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A).
  • About 7 in 10 pedestrian accident victims are male.

Common causes of pedestrian accidents

  • Speeding
  • Cell phone use
  • Failure to stop at traffic signals and stop signs
  • Jaywalking
  • Poor visibility
  • Lack of pedestrian-friendly infrastructure
  • Impaired driving or walking

Common pedestrian accident injuries 

Because pedestrians are far more vulnerable than motorists in the event of an accident, they often face catastrophic injuries. Some common injuries that injured pedestrians face include:

  • Traumatic brain injuries
  • Spinal cord injuries
  • Broken bones
  • Broken or missing teeth
  • Internal organ damage
  • Lacerations and bruising

California Pedestrian Laws and Information


senior man walking along city crosswalk

Where can pedestrians cross the street?

California Vehicle Code §21950 states that motor vehicles must yield the right-of-way to pedestrians crossing in a marked crosswalk or in an unmarked crosswalk at an intersection. 

A pedestrian still has a duty of care for their own safety—they may not step or run in front of a car that is so close the driver will not have time to stop. 

A pedestrian may not unnecessarily stop or delay traffic while in a crosswalk.

Where should pedestrians walk when there is no sidewalk?

If no sidewalk is present, pedestrians should take care to stay as far away from traffic as possible. Walk against the flow of traffic (typically on the left side of the road).

What is the statute of limitations for a pedestrian accident?

Like most other legal actions, personal injury cases are subject to a statute of limitations. This acts as a time limit for bringing about a claim. After the period of time has passed, the plaintiff loses their right of action.

Under California law, the statute of limitations for personal injury claims is generally two years.

What should I do after a pedestrian accident?

If you have been injured as a pedestrian, take the following steps to protect your right to a claim:

  • Move out of traffic if possible.
  • Check for injuries and call 911 if necessary.
  • File a police report.
  • Exchange names, phone numbers, addresses, and insurance information with the motorist.
  • Get contact information of any witnesses.
  • Notify your own auto insurance provider of the accident.
  • Seek medical attention, even if you do not believe you are injured.
  • Consider contacting a personal injury attorney.

Do not apologize or admit fault for the accident. An investigation may prove that you are not liable.

What damages can I seek in a pedestrian accident case?

Depending on the circumstances surrounding your accident, you may be able to seek some of the following damages in a pedestrian accident lawsuit:

  • Medical expenses
  • Lost wages
  • Loss of future earning capacity
  • Pain and suffering
  • Funeral and burial expenses (in the case of wrongful death)

A personal injury lawyer can help you understand your legal options and determine the worth of your case. Ultimately, your settlement offer will depend on the severity of your injuries, how much treatment you require, and whether you were partially liable for the accident.
